Benefits of All-Ceramic Dental Crowns
A dental crown can provide strength, restore function, and enhance the look of a tooth with severe decay, a failing filling, or susceptibility to breakage. By addressing these issues with all-ceramic crowns, you can secure a more durable solution for preserving a healthy smile.

Understanding the Dental Crown Procedure
Getting a dental crown involves multiple steps. Initially, our San Jose dentists will assess your teeth to determine if a crown is necessary. If so, they will remove some enamel to accommodate the crown. A mold of the tooth will then be created to ensure a perfect fit for the crown. A temporary crown will be placed to protect the tooth while the permanent crown is being made. Once ready, the permanent crown will be securely attached to restore the tooth's function and appearance.
